基于实例推理的模具设计技术研究
2014-11-30郑德宇
郑德宇
(重庆机电职业技术学院,重庆 402760)
0 引言
在实际的模具设计中,模具设计经验是有着极其重要的作用。模具的设计是建立在知识及经验的基础上的,设计者通过其固有的设计经验充分应用好过往的技能、资料等进行加工再利用,进行科学合理的模具设计,是符合基于实例推理的模具设计技术(CBR)的应用领域的。该技术可以对以往的抽象知识进行规制的构建和演算操作,基于已有的实例解决问题,通过修正改进,创造新的设计知识。实例概念的设计主要是基于产品的性质和功能之上的,一步一步建立起来,创建设计方案。
1 设计系统
模具设计是以最基本的知识理论以及经验进行再创作的复杂的工作,如果要实现整个过程的信息智能效果,那么我国当前的技术、理论、经济等环境下是没有办法实现的,但是可以在一定程度上实现。
2 实例表示
模具设计实例的表示就是对实例的内容、机构进行再次确定,是建立在实例推理技术的基础之上的。因为其表示方法直接关系到推理的效率和准确度,准确、有效、完整的表达设计实例是进行基于实例模具设计的重要性步骤。
3 检索策略
3.1 相似度
模具实例的相似度是进行判断以往模具设计实例间相似性的尺度标准,其作用主要是用来对整体实例库中与新的问题最接近实例的判断。但是,其相似度是存在变化的。
假设对象是X、Y相似的度则应sim(X,Y)表示,则sim(X,Y)∈[0,1],同时满足以下条件的对称性即:sim(X,Y)=sim(Y,X);其自反性为:sim(X,X)=sim(X,X)。如果用元组(P1,P2,....,Pn)表示匹配的新问题描述,元组(u1,u2,...un)表示库中检索到的案例描述,那么它们的加权平均的相似度的计算公式可表示为:
其中,P表示要进行匹配的新问题的描述;Pi是P的第一个属性;u表示实例库中的源实例,ui是u的第一个属性;m表示的是问题描述部分的属性值,wi表示第一个属性的局部相似度权重。
3.2 算法的描述
在基于实例推理的模具设计技术系统中,检索是实例技术设计的极其重要的环节,它的作用主要体现在,与系统的索引方式存在一定程度上的关联,同时,它与固有的中的查询功能有着很大的区别。在基于实例推理的模具设计技术系统模具设计实例检索中有部分是不确定的,有着很大的差异性。另外,基于实例推理的模具设计技术系统的实例检索的条件只是对实例问题部分属性的描述,而不是全部的描述。
假设实例u∈R,如果存在实例c∈R,对所有的实例c1∈R,使得sim(u,c)≥sim(u,c1)则是成立的,那么将实例c称为实例u的最近邻居NNc,记作为:
NNc(u,c)可以相互推到出R:sim(u,c)≧sim(u,c1)。
模具设计实例实际系统的应用中,把设计实例的u用问题实例p代替,可以从中找出与新的设计内容最为接近相似的内容。然而,当模具设计的实例库中的某一个实例c是问题实例P的最为接近的邻居时,它的解决模式几倍称之为问题实例P所代表的新问题建议解。在特定的情况,实例间的相似度或者接近程度可以很有效的进行检索优化,提高设计工作的效率和质量。
3.4 实例检索
实例检索是基于实例推理的模具设计技术研究中重要内容。其原理是根据新的设计要求与问题相关资料,基于某一种评价参数或者标准,进而从实例中检索出与其可以再一定程度上可以匹配,同时其保持较高的水平,对新的问题进行求解得出其实用的例子。
该种实例检索是在特定的实例库中进行的,与我们生活中互联网的检索是存在很大区别的。实例的检索主要包括索引的参数标准,即:(1)可预见性;(2)可表示的实例作用和意义;(3)可充分的简洁化,可在后续操作中拓展;(4)十分具体,方便后续操作的识别。模具设计的实例检索的方式是,由上到下的方式,从而形成检索字典以及相关问题描述限制在一定可操作、可控可管理的范围之内。准确无误的检索到模具设计实例的相关信息,也是系统的重要体现。随着研究的不断创新和发展,形成了较为便捷的方式,归纳推理以及引导策略。
4 结语
基于实例推理的模具设计技术是对以往知识的重新使用的重要方式,其根本实质在于运用对以往的问题的处理方式对把新出现的问题进行再次处理。运用基于实例推理的设计技术,把模具设计中的问题,运用过往的设计知识进行再次利用,再配以科学、恰当的检索算法,对模具设计及模具的制造,有着积极重要的作用和意义。
[1]戚占龙.基于实例推理的模具设计研究[J].西北工业大学,2010(06):112-114.
[2]田锡天等.基于实例推理的模具设计技术研究[J].计算机工程与应用,2009(21):67-68.